嵌入式应用开发智能设备系统设计与软件编程
什么是嵌入式应用开发?
在当今这个信息爆炸的时代,随着科技的飞速发展,各种各样的电子设备如同无处不在地融入到了我们的生活中。从智能手机到汽车导航,从家庭电器到工业控制装置,这些设备背后都有一个核心技术——嵌入式应用开发。这是一个集硬件和软件于一体的高科技领域,它涉及到对微型计算机系统进行精细化设计,以实现特定的功能。
如何理解嵌入式应用开发?
要真正理解嵌入式应用开发,我们首先需要明确它的定义。简单来说,嵌入式系统就是将计算机系统及其相关部件作为一种组件,将其内置于其他产品之中,以实现某种特定功能。例如,一台智能家居控制器就可能包含了一个小型电脑芯片来管理各种传感器和执行器以提供自动化服务。而这台小型电脑芯片正是通过嵌入式应用开发所完成的工作。
哪些因素影响着嵌实性质?
在实际操作中,嵌入式系统面临着诸多挑战。一方面,由于资源有限(比如说CPU速度、内存容量等),程序员必须优化代码,使其能够高效运行;另一方面,对外部环境的适应性也是至关重要的,比如抗噪声能力、能耗控制等。此外,还有硬件兼容性的问题以及用户界面的友好度等,都会对最终产品产生重大影响。
如何进行有效的测试和调试?
为了确保产品质量,不断地进行测试和调试是必不可少的一环。在此过程中,可以采用模拟环境或真实场景来验证程序是否按预期执行,同时也可以利用仿真工具来减少成本并加快迭代周期。此外,在整个流程中还需保持沟通与协作,不仅包括工程师之间,还包括跨部门团队成员间,以便快速解决问题并推进项目进展。
为什么选择成为一名专业的人才?
如果你对技术充满热情,并且愿意不断学习新知识,那么成为一名专业的人才可能是个非常好的选择。在这个领域,你可以参与创造前沿科技,为人们带去更方便、高效、安全可靠的地理信息服务。如果你愿意承担挑战,并且享受不断探索未知世界的心境,那么加入这一行,无疑是一次难得机会。
未来趋势是什么样子?
随着物联网(IoT)技术日益成熟,以及人工智能(AI)逐渐渗透到各个行业,未来对于嵌入式应用开发者提出了新的要求。不仅要具备扎实基础知识,更需要掌握最新技术,如云计算、大数据分析以及边缘计算等。这意味着职业发展道路充满了新的可能性,而同时,也伴随着持续更新换代的情形,让每位从业者都必须保持学习态度,与时俱进。